Output cdd7680964bfd411fa760ee5077631bd3b6c5586fb3d87b8399ae08a9fe1cc94:8

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 80fab039ea8e552198e163578583fea4c0a69d08
address
bc1qsratqw023e2jrx8pvdtctql75nq2d8ggncx65l
transaction
cdd7680964bfd411fa760ee5077631bd3b6c5586fb3d87b8399ae08a9fe1cc94
spent
true